Women's Basketball Drops Home Game 53-47 to East Texas Baptist JV
Lockesburg, Ark. - UA Cossatot women's basketball lost on Tuesday night, falling 53-47 to East Texas Baptist JV at the Bank of Lockesburg Gymnasium.
November 11, 2025
The Colts (0-4) could not hold onto their halftime lead, as the Tigers came back to win in the second half.
ETBU won the first quarter, being up 16-15 after the first 10 minutes.
UAC was able to respond in the second quarter, as they took a 34-24 lead into halftime by winning the quarter 19-8.
Freshman guard Denezjha Robinson was red hot in the first half, connecting on four three-pointers and totaling 14 points.
Despite a 9-0 run by East Texas Baptist to start the third quarter 59 get within one, UA Cossatot straightened things out to take a 43-39 lead going into the final 10 minutes.
Another strong run out of the gate from the Tigers followed though, tying the game before taking the lead with 6:34 to go. ETBU held on the rest of the way, winning 53-47.
Robinson was the leading scorer with 14.
The Colts are off for 10 days, as they will play at Dallas College Mountain View on Friday, November 21 at noon.
